Five-year-old injured after being struck by vehicle

Summary by WPRI 12
PROVIDENCE, R.I. (WPRI) -- A five-year-old boy was injured after being struck by a vehicle Friday evening. According to a city spokesperson, Providence police were called to Roger Williams Park for a report of a pedestrian struck. When they arrived on scene, officers learned that a five-year-old boy ran between two vehicles to cross the road and was struck.
